Who we are

Recharge is the leader in powering physical subscriptions, making it one of the most important ecommerce engines. Recharge powers over 50M subscriptions worldwide and has processed more than 10B in transactions. More than 15K brands such as Verve Coffee Roasters, Bokksu, Who Gives A Crap, Geologie, Bite Toothpaste Bits and The Sill rely on Recharge daily to grow their businesses and delight their customers.

Recharge’s mission is to enable brands and merchants to form strong, lasting relationships with their customers through recurring purchases. As merchants seek ways to drive more direct sales and distribution through their channels and move away from a reliance on traditional online marketing strategies, Recharge has made it possible to grow businesses with seamless, recurring customer transactions.

Bootstrapped until 2020, Recharge is valued at over 2.1B dollars and is a double unicorn with a total raise of 277M dollars. Join us as we work with our merchants to define the future of ecommerce.

Overview

We’re looking for a Senior Product Designer to join our Product and Product Design team. As a Senior Product Designer at Recharge, you’ll craft clean, user-friendly experiences and design world-class features for our merchants and their customers. 

What You’ll Do

  • Live by and champion our values: #day-one, #ownership, #empathy, #humility.
  • Improve the merchant and shopper experience with beautiful and functional designs for new features, existing feature improvements, and overall design direction. 
  • Own impactful projects from start to finish. Your work will inform every facet of the product, from new themes for our merchants’ subscription management portals to a new and improved merchant onboarding experience. Your work has meaning and direct impact on our merchants and their customers. 
  • Collaborate with a variety of disciplines. You’ll work hand-in-hand with engineers, product managers, front-end developers, and the creative team to execute your designs. 
  • You’ll work within established components and brand standards while always thinking about and demonstrating how we can elevate our brand and product.

What You’ll Bring

  • 3+ years of product design experience
  • Bias towards shipping quickly and constantly delivering value to merchants, end customers, and internal admins
  • Ability to break an experience into deliverable milestones without sacrificing user experience and quality
  • Proficiency with current industry design tools (Figma)
  • A thorough understanding of the end-to-end iterative design process including research, wireframing, prototyping, user testing, and high-fidelity mockups 
  • Experience collaborating with multi-disciplinary teams including product managers, engineers, front-end developers, and other stakeholders
  • Familiarity with HTML, CSS, and JavaScript
  • A portfolio of recent work highlighting the user experience process
  • Exceptional communication skills, particularly written
  • Ability to work remote-first in a high growth company
